Annette Simmons Hutto, 92, of Quitman, MS, passed away on July 31, 2023, at Wisteria Manor surrounded by her loving family.
She was born on November 28, 1930, to Ralph and Cora (Estess) Simmons in Pike County, MS.
Annette was a graduate of the University of Southern Mississippi with her Bachelor's Degree in Library Science and second Bachelor's Degree in Social Work. She retired after 30 plus years of service to the Mississippi Department of Human Services for Clarke County, MS. She served on the Board of Directors for H. C. Watkins Memorial Hospital, in Quitman, MS. She also served in numerous other community organizations such as the Quitman Lions Club, Quitman Woman's Club, and Clarke County Chamber of Commerce (where she was elected as Citizen of the Year in 2002). She was a longtime member of the First United Methodist Church of Quitman, MS. She was a loving Mother, Grandmother and Great-Grandmother and a friend that gave unselfishly of herself and her talents to enrich the lives of others.
